Status 710 means the registration was cancelled because a required Section 8 declaration of continued use was not filed within the deadline (including any grace period). The federal registration is no longer active. Evaluate filing a new application if you still use the mark, or petition if cancellation was erroneous. Consult counsel on remaining common-law rights.
